Checking out the Future of Automation Testing in Software Program Growth
Checking out the Future of Automation Testing in Software Program Growth
Blog Article
The Future of Software Application Development: Using the Prospective of Automation Evaluating for Faster, More Trusted Releases
The possible benefits of automation testing are huge, encouraging not only to speed up release cycles however additionally to boost the overall quality and consistency of software application items. In a landscape where rate and accuracy are paramount, utilizing the capabilities of automation testing stands as a critical strategy for staying ahead.
The Power of Automation Evaluating
In the world of software development, the implementation of automation testing has shown to significantly improve performance and quality control procedures. By automating time-consuming and repetitive manual testing jobs, software teams can streamline their testing initiatives, lower human mistakes, and speed up the general advancement lifecycle. Automation testing enables for the quick implementation of examination situations across different environments and configurations, supplying programmers with fast comments on the quality of their code changes.
One of the crucial benefits of automation testing is its ability to raise examination coverage, making sure that more features and capabilities are thoroughly tested. This thorough testing strategy assists identify issues early in the growth cycle, minimizing the possibility of pricey insects reaching production. Automation testing advertises continuous combination and continuous distribution methods, enabling groups to release software application updates more frequently and accurately.
Accelerating Release Cycles
The velocity of release cycles in software application growth is essential for remaining competitive in the quickly evolving tech landscape. Reducing the time between launches allows business to react quickly to market needs, integrate customer feedback immediately, and outpace competitors in providing innovative functions. By adopting nimble techniques and leveraging automation screening devices, growth teams can improve their processes, determine pests previously, and guarantee a higher high quality item with each launch.
Accelerating release cycles also allows software program firms to keep a competitive edge by swiftly attending to protection susceptabilities and adjusting to altering governing needs. Moreover, constant launches aid in structure consumer trust fund and commitment as customers gain from constant enhancements and bug fixes. This iterative method fosters a society of continual enhancement within advancement teams, encouraging cooperation, development, and a concentrate on supplying value to end-users.
Guaranteeing Consistent Quality Control
Consistent high quality guarantee involves a methodical approach to screening and assessing software program to identify and correct any kind of defects or issues immediately. This consists of defining clear quality requirements, performing complete screening at each phase of development, and leveraging automation testing tools to improve the procedure.
Conquering Common Screening Challenges
Addressing and settling typical screening difficulties is crucial for guaranteeing the performance and efficiency of software program advancement procedures. This problem can be mitigated by detailed test preparation, incorporating diverse testing methods, and leveraging automation testing to improve coverage. In addition, find more information coordinating screening initiatives across different groups and divisions can posture a difficulty due to interaction gaps and varying concerns.
Applying Automation Checking Approaches
Having actually efficiently navigated common testing challenges, the next tactical emphasis depends on effectively executing automation screening to enhance software application development procedures. Automation testing techniques entail the usage of specialized frameworks and devices to automate repetitive jobs, reduce hand-operated intervention, and raise the speed and accuracy of screening. To execute automation screening successfully, an extensive approach ought to be developed, beginning with identifying the best examination cases for automation based upon criteria such as frequency of intricacy, criticality, and usage.
Continual combination and release pipes can even more improve the automation testing process by instantly causing examinations whenever brand-new code is dedicated. By embracing automation screening methods, software program advancement teams can achieve faster examining cycles, greater test protection, and ultimately supply even more reputable software launches.
Final Thought
In final thought, automation testing gives an effective tool for read here increasing release cycles, ensuring regular quality control, and overcoming usual testing obstacles in software application development. By utilizing the potential of automation screening strategies, companies can achieve much faster and much more dependable launches. automation testing. Accepting automation screening is necessary for staying affordable in the fast-paced world of software advancement
By automating repeated and lengthy hands-on testing tasks, software groups can simplify their screening initiatives, minimize human mistakes, and increase the overall growth lifecycle.Having actually successfully browsed common screening difficulties, the following critical emphasis lies in successfully implementing automation testing to optimize software application growth procedures. Automation screening techniques involve the usage of specialized frameworks and devices to automate repeated tasks, lower hands-on intervention, and enhance the rate and precision of testing. To apply automation testing efficiently, a comprehensive strategy needs to be established, beginning with determining the right examination situations for automation based on requirements such as frequency of intricacy, criticality, and usage.
In conclusion, automation screening supplies an effective tool for increasing release cycles, click over here now ensuring regular quality guarantee, and conquering usual testing obstacles in software advancement.
Report this page